Group 14 element cationic pentagonal–pyramidal complexes Ea[η5-Eb5(SiMe3)5]+ (Ea = Si–Pb, Eb = Si, Ge): A quantum-chemical study

ABSTRACT

Heavy 14 group element cationic half-sandwich complexes Ea5-Eb5(SiMe3)5]+ (Ea = Si–Pb, Eb = Si, Ge) have been studied at the B3LYP/Def2TZVP level of theory. Structures of the neutral complexes {Si[Si5(SiMe3)5]}+Cl and {Si[Si5(SiMe3)5]}+[AlCl4] are also discussed.
